Tanium Launches App for Splunk Enterprise to Extend Reach of Real-Time Cyber Threat Neutralization

Berkeley, Calif., October 7, 2014 – Systems and security management company Tanium today announced the Tanium App for Splunk® Enterprise. The Tanium App for Splunk Enterprise leverages Tanium’s endpoint threat detection and response capabilities to collect and analyze that data in Splunk Enterprise, a Big Data security analytics platform, to better understand cyber threats and anomalies detected in Tanium data.

The Tanium App for Splunk Enterprise asks a fixed set of questions to all Tanium agents. It then brings the data into Splunk Enterprise for analysis, correlation, alerting and visualization. The app offers drill-down details on such critical items as application and process information, suspicious open ports, external connections, network information, as well as detailed asset management data gathered by Tanium agents. Splunk Enterprise’s enrichment capabilities can add context provided by external machine data sources across the enterprise. Splunk Enterprise also enables correlation of Tanium’s endpoint threat detection information with network level data, external threat intelligence feeds, or any application data point that is relevant in solving the security equation.
